The Rise of Betting in Tanzania: Trends, Regulations, and Opportunities

Overview of Betting in Tanzania

Betting in Tanzania has evolved significantly over the past decade, driven by the rise of online betting Tanzania and the growing popularity of sports betting Tanzania. As mobile internet penetration increases, more residents are accessing platforms that offer a wide range of betting options, from football matches to cricket and even virtual sports. This shift is reshaping the betting industry growth in the country, with operators adapting to meet the demand for convenience, variety, and secure transactions. The integration of mobile money services has further simplified the betting process, making it accessible to a broader demographic.

Legal Framework and Regulatory Bodies

The Tanzanian betting regulations are overseen by the Tanzania Communications Regulatory Authority (TCRA) and the Tanzania Revenue Authority (TRA), which ensure compliance with licensing requirements and taxation policies. While traditional betting was historically limited to land-based operators, the emergence of online betting Tanzania has prompted regulatory updates to address digital platforms. For instance, the TCRA’s 2020 guidelines for internet service providers now include provisions for monitoring online gambling activities. Operators must obtain licenses to operate legally, and consumers are encouraged to verify the legitimacy of platforms before engaging. Economic Impact of the Betting Industry

The betting industry growth in Tanzania contributes to the economy through job creation, tax revenues, and the development of ancillary services like cybersecurity and payment gateways. Local operators and international firms alike invest in marketing campaigns targeting Tanzanian audiences, fostering competition and innovation. Additionally, betting platforms often sponsor community projects and sports teams, aligning with corporate social responsibility goals. However, the sector’s potential remains untapped, with opportunities for further integration into the formal economy through clearer Tanzanian betting regulations.

Responsible Betting and Consumer Protection

Responsible betting Tanzania initiatives are gaining attention as operators introduce tools like self-exclusion options, spending limits, and educational campaigns about gambling addiction. Regulatory bodies are also urged to enforce stricter penalties for predatory marketing tactics. While progress is being made, more resources are needed to support individuals affected by problem gambling. By fostering a culture of accountability, the betting industry growth in Tanzania can coexist with public health priorities.
